About Snijlab

Snijlab is a laser cutting service. Our customers create a design, and we cut it from plastic and wooden sheets. With our easy ordering process, we make laser cutting accessible to businesses and individuals. We serve the creative and technical sectors.

Lasersheets, our subsidiary, sells sheet materials to people who own a laser cutter. Here, we apply the same knowledge to a different target audience.
